Global Wind Turbine Control System Market size was valued at USD 8.4 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 9.14 Billion in 2025 to USD 17.94 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 8.8%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The global wind turbine control system market is evolving rapidly, driven by a need for optimized energy yield and operational safety amid increasing decarbonization initiatives. This market includes both hardware and software that manage critical functions such as blade pitch and generator torque. The transition from traditional mechanical systems to digital platforms enhances performance, leveraging advanced analytics and model predictive controls to improve uptime and reduce operational costs. The integration of AI technologies facilitates smarter decision-making, enabling adaptive controllers and predictive maintenance that significantly enhance reliability. As a result, utilities and operators benefit from reduced unplanned downtime, longer component life, and streamlined service agreements, positioning AI as a crucial element in fulfilling the market's growing demands.

Driver of the Global Wind Turbine Control System Market
The Global Wind Turbine Control System market is significantly driven by ongoing advancements in control algorithms that provide enhanced precision in blade pitch and yaw adjustments, resulting in improved aerodynamic efficiency and steady energy output despite varying wind conditions. These sophisticated algorithms also enable seamless integration with grid demands, support predictive maintenance through effective sensor data analysis, and minimize unplanned outages while prolonging the lifespan of components. As the intelligence behind these controls becomes more refined, operators can maximize the performance of entire wind farms and effectively manage multiple turbines, ultimately boosting overall energy production and reliability. Such advancements highlight the tangible benefits in performance, availability, and lifecycle management, fostering increased investment and widespread adoption in the sector.
Restraints in the Global Wind Turbine Control System Market
The adoption of Global Wind Turbine Control Systems is significantly constrained by complex integration demands and high implementation costs, which elevate project intricacies and perceived risks for developers and operators. The process of retrofitting advanced control systems into pre-existing turbines generally entails substantial engineering efforts, customization, and extensive collaboration among various vendors, leading to prolonged commissioning periods and heightened financial expectations. Moreover, the lack of compatibility between legacy equipment and contemporary platforms creates challenges in integration testing and necessitates additional workforce training, which can deter operators with limited resources. These qualitative challenges inhibit rapid technology adoption and make stakeholders more hesitant to invest in comprehensive system upgrades.
Market Trends of the Global Wind Turbine Control System Market
The Global Wind Turbine Control System market is experiencing a significant shift towards integrated digital control solutions, which enhance operational efficiency through advanced monitoring, analytics, and predictive maintenance. As operators seek greater interoperability and modular designs supported by cloud services, vendors are optimizing product lifecycles and ensuring streamlined delivery. The focus on cybersecurity and standardized interfaces is growing, minimizing operational risks and reducing dependency on single suppliers. Collaborations among control system providers, cloud technology firms, and service specialists are evolving, leading to scalable solutions that boost turbine availability, streamline upgrades, and enhance performance metrics for wind farm operators.
